Steps to Take Before Engagement

Before providing any personal information or making any payments, it’s crucial to perform thorough due diligence.

  • Verify Company Registration and Licenses:

    • Paragraphs: The most critical step is to try and verify if “Safe Voyages Tours” is a legally registered entity in India and if it holds the necessary licenses to operate as a tour operator. You can typically do this by searching the official registers of the Ministry of Corporate Affairs (MCA) in India or contacting relevant tourism boards. A legitimate company should be easily verifiable.
      • Search India’s Ministry of Corporate Affairs website for “Safe Voyages Tours.”
      • Check if they are members of recognized Indian travel associations (e.g., IATO, TAAI) and verify their membership directly with the association.
      • Contact the Indian Ministry of Tourism or local tourism departments in Delhi to inquire about their licensing status.

  • Scrutinize Payment Methods:

    • Paragraphs: Pay close attention to the payment methods requested. Reputable online travel agencies use secure payment gateways that process credit card payments directly on a secure platform (indicated by “https://” and a padlock icon in the URL, and often by a payment processor logo). Be wary if they ask for direct bank transfers to personal accounts, cryptocurrency, or unconventional payment methods that offer no buyer protection.
      • Prioritize credit card payments, which offer chargeback protection.
      • Avoid direct bank transfers to individual names or accounts.
      • Confirm the payment gateway is secure (HTTPS, PCI DSS compliance).
      • Be cautious of requests for upfront, full payments without proper documentation.
    • Bold Highlights: Always use secure payment methods with buyer protection, like credit cards.

What to Do If You’ve Already Engaged

  • Document Everything:

    • Paragraphs: Collect every piece of communication: emails, WhatsApp messages, screenshots of the website, transaction details, and any payment confirmations. This documentation will be vital if you need to dispute charges or report potential fraud.
      • Save all email correspondence.
      • Screenshot chat logs (WhatsApp).
      • Keep records of bank statements or credit card transactions.
      • Note down dates, times, and names of individuals you spoke with.

  • Contact Your Bank or Credit Card Company Immediately:

    • Paragraphs: If you paid by credit card, contact your card issuer immediately to report the situation. Explain that you believe you may have engaged with a potentially fraudulent or non-transparent business and wish to dispute the charge. Credit card companies often have strong consumer protection policies that allow for chargebacks.
      • Call your credit card company’s fraud department.
      • Explain the lack of T&Cs, Privacy Policy, and verifiable business info.
      • Provide all documented evidence.
      • Request a chargeback for the transaction.

  • Report to Relevant Authorities:

    • Paragraphs: File a complaint with consumer protection agencies in your country (e.g., the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) in the U.S., your national consumer protection agency) and potentially with Indian authorities if the company is based there. While individual cases might not always be resolved, collective complaints can lead to investigations and help prevent others from falling victim.
      • File a complaint with the FTC (for U.S. residents) or your local consumer protection agency.
      • Consider reporting to cybercrime units if you suspect fraud.
      • If in India, file a complaint with the National Consumer Helpline or the Ministry of Tourism.
